pg数据库连接超时怎么回事
服务故障:可能是由于pg服务在运行过程中出现了故障或异常,导致数据库连接不上。重启pg服务可以解决这个问题,因为重启会重新启动服务,并恢复正常运行。
网络。默认的超时设置太长如果外网网络状况不佳,可能会导致连接断掉,为了安全性默认的连接超时时间很短经常就是发个呆就断开了。
连接超时的原因是网络断开、网络阻塞、网络不稳定、系统问题、设备不稳定。网络断开 不过经常显示无法连接;建议检查一下网线,更换一下其他网络接口尝试一下。网络阻塞 导致你不能在程序默认等待时间内得到回复数据包。
目标数据库是否开启了服务。目标数据库是否开启了监听。目标服务器是否有防火墙或是网络策略限制不允许访问。检查下访问的配置是否正确,如IP、端口号、用户信息等等。访问账号的连接数是否过多等等。
如何导入PostgreSQL数据库数据
1、运行“命令提示符”。切换至PostgreSQL数据库安装目录中的bin目录下。执行此目录下的shp2pgsql命令:“shp2pgsql c:\road.shp road c:\road.sql”。
2、登录NineData控制台。 在左侧导航栏中选择数据源管理数据源。 单击“创建数据源”按钮,在弹出的数据源类型弹窗中选择“自建数据库”,然后选择“PostgreSQL”作为数据源类型。
3、步骤:将excel表格字段,按照postgresql 数据库中表的字段顺序来整理数据,并保存为csv文件。用记事本打开csv文件,另存为UTF-8格式。
postgresql无法正常启动的原因追查
数据库锁定异常:多个并发事务访问同一数据时可能出现锁定异常; 数据库崩溃:数据库程序崩溃或发生硬件故障等原因导致数据库无法正常工作。
看看服务里的 Postgres 服务的用户名、密码,必须用 postres 用户启动的。
这可能是服务器崩溃了,看看是不是有病毒打开了太多的端口,netstat -na 一般不上网时十几个是正常的,几十个就有问题了。5432端口是postgresql默认端口。另外,检查一下服务器日志,还有windows日志,看看是不是有异常。
服务故障:可能是由于pg服务在运行过程中出现了故障或异常,导致数据库连接不上。重启pg服务可以解决这个问题,因为重启会重新启动服务,并恢复正常运行。
解决办法是将整个postgreSQL安装目录附一个Everyone的权限。启动,还是不成功,于是查看data/pg_log目录下的日志信息,发现无法创建inherite socket。 解决办法是运行 netsh winsock reset,然后重启系统。
PLSQL中文乱码?
1、plsql查询出来的中文乱码,一般就是她不支持,这是转换的时候反正出了差错。
2、查询oracle server端的字符集。打开PLSQL的查询窗口中输入下面SQL查询语句。
3、首先在电脑上找到并打开PLSQL,弹出登陆界面,进去登陆。然后随便写了一个查询语句,发现显示有乱码。这时先查看oracle服务器端的字符编码是什么。
pg导入sql文件乱码导致失败的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于pg库导入sql文件、pg导入sql文件乱码导致失败的信息别忘了在本站进行查找喔。